1
0
mirror of https://github.com/kmein/niveum synced 2026-03-16 18:21:07 +01:00
Files
niveum/configs/polkit.nix

12 lines
296 B
Nix
Raw Normal View History

2022-03-10 21:52:12 +01:00
{config, ...}: let
user = config.users.users.me.name;
2022-03-10 21:52:12 +01:00
in {
security.polkit.extraConfig = ''
polkit.addRule(function(action, subject) {
if (subject.user == "${user}" && action.id == "org.freedesktop.systemd1.manage-units") {
return polkit.Result.YES;
}
});
'';
}